Mastering Algo Trading in Forex: A Comprehensive Guide for Traders

The foreign exchange market is certainly one of the largest and maximum liquid financial markets in the international, with over $6 trillion traded daily. This massive quantity gives numerous possibilities for buyers, but it additionally offers full-size demanding situations. The want to investigate big quantities of information, make brief selections, and adapt to constantly shifting market conditions can be overwhelming. This is where algo trading in forex comes into play, revolutionizing the manner buyers operate and giving them the tools to compete in this fast-paced surroundings.
What is Algo Trading in Forex?
Algorithmic buying and selling, or algo buying and selling, refers to the usage of pc packages and algorithms to execute trades based totally on pre-defined criteria. These algorithms can analyze marketplace records, perceive buying and selling opportunities, and execute trades in actual-time with out human intervention. In the context of foreign exchange, algo trading is designed to capitalize on fluctuations in forex charges, presenting investors with an green and systematic manner to go into and go out trades.
Algorithms can be programmed to observe a huge variety of strategies, from simple regulations like shifting averages to complex ones regarding statistical fashions and system mastering. The Forex market traders use these algorithms to routinely execute trades on the high-quality viable prices, minimizing guide effort and emotional decision-making.
The Benefits of Algo Trading in the Forex market
1. Speed and Efficiency
One of the most obvious blessings of algo buying and selling in foreign exchange is the rate with which trades are carried out. The Forex market markets pass rapidly, and opportunities can appear and disappear in a matter of seconds. Algorithms can method large quantities of information and execute trades inside milliseconds, a ways faster than any human trader ought to react.
This speed permits traders to capitalize on brief-time period charge actions, along with arbitrage opportunities or short market inefficiencies, which might be frequently too fleeting for manual buyers to exploit.
2. Removing Emotional Bias
Emotion is one of the best challenges for buyers. Fear, greed, and overconfidence can result in impulsive selections that bring about poor trading results. Algorithms, but, are proof against feelings. They execute trades primarily based on predetermined rules, making sure that buying and selling techniques are accompanied consistently and without deviation.
This objectivity is important in volatile forex markets, wherein unexpected price swings can cause emotional reactions that lead to pricey errors.
3. Consistency in Execution
Algo buying and selling offers traders consistency in executing strategies. Once an set of rules is programmed, it executes trades systematically consistent with the logic it follows. This reduces the danger of human error and ensures that buyers stick with their strategies even in rapid-transferring or worrying marketplace situations.
For instance, a dealer may expand a profitable approach based totally on historical price styles but fail to enforce it constantly because of feelings or distractions. An algorithmic system guarantees that those strategies are carried out flawlessly every time, no matter marketplace situations.
4. Backtesting and Optimization
Backtesting is a important feature of algorithmic trading, permitting investors to test their strategies against historic facts. Before deploying an set of rules in stay buying and selling, investors can use backtesting to assess how the strategy might have achieved in the past and pick out ability weaknesses or regions for development.
Backtesting may be a effective tool for refining techniques and constructing self assurance earlier than risking real capital within the market. This additionally enables traders optimize their algorithms, great-tuning parameters to maximize profitability and decrease danger.
5. Trading Multiple Currency Pairs Simultaneously
The forex market operates 24/five, and investors regularly face the assignment of tracking a couple of currency pairs throughout unique time zones. Algorithms may be programmed to display a couple of foreign money pairs simultaneously, identify trading possibilities in numerous markets, and execute trades as a result.
This lets in buyers to amplify their reach and take gain of opportunities in extraordinary parts of the sector without being constrained to 1 marketplace or time region. In essence, algo trading permits a degree of marketplace participation that could be impossible to achieve manually.
Strategies for Algo Trading in Forex
There are numerous common algorithmic buying and selling techniques that foreign exchange buyers can put in force, each desirable to unique market conditions and trading dreams. Some of the maximum famous strategies include:
1. Trend Following
Trend-following algorithms are designed to become aware of and follow long-term rate developments within the market. These strategies are based on the concept that when a forex pair establishes a fashion, it is probable to preserve in that direction for some time.
2. Mean Reversion
Mean reversion is based totally on the belief that fees will eventually revert to their historical common. When a foreign money pair’s charge actions too far from its average, a mean reversion algorithm will execute a trade, betting that the price will go back to its common variety.
3. Arbitrage
Arbitrage strategies involve taking advantage of fee discrepancies among specific markets or exchanges. In foreign exchange, those discrepancies may also occur among one-of-a-kind brokers or forex pairs. For example, an set of rules might come across that EUR/USD is trading at slightly specific fees on unique exchanges and execute simultaneous purchase and promote orders to profit from the distinction.
4. High-Frequency Trading (HFT)
High-frequency trading is a subset of algo trading that involves executing a large range of trades in a very short duration, frequently inside milliseconds. HFT algorithms intention to make the most of small price changes that arise over a brief time body.
5. News-Based Trading
News-based totally trading algorithms analyze real-time news feeds and economic records releases to pick out trading opportunities. For instance, a information-based totally set of rules might display essential financial announcements inclusive of interest price changes or employment reviews and execute trades based available on the market’s reaction.
Challenges of Algo Trading in Forex
While algo trading gives severa blessings, it isn’t always without its challenges. Traders ought to be privy to the capacity risks and limitations before fully committing to this method.
1. Market Volatility
Forex markets are relatively unstable, and algorithms can also conflict to perform in excessive situations. Sudden, sharp fee moves due to geopolitical activities, unexpected economic statistics, or vital bank interventions can result in considerable losses if the algorithm isn’t programmed to deal with such eventualities.
2. Over-Optimization
Over-optimization takes place whilst traders great-tune their algorithms an excessive amount of based totally on past facts, resulting in a approach that plays well in backtesting but poorly in live buying and selling. This is because marketplace conditions are continuously changing, and a strategy that worked inside the beyond won’t necessarily paintings within the future.
3. Technical Failures
Algo buying and selling systems are dependent on generation, and any technical failure—such as a server crash, net outage, or software program glitch—can bring about ignored trades or unintended marketplace publicity. To mitigate this hazard, buyers must put money into reliable infrastructure and feature backup structures in place.
4. Regulatory Scrutiny
The upward thrust of algorithmic buying and selling has attracted attention from regulators, who are involved approximately its effect on marketplace stability. Some jurisdictions have imposed guidelines to restriction sure varieties of high-frequency buying and selling and ensure truthful marketplace practices. Forex investors the usage of algo trading need to stay knowledgeable about regulations that can have an effect on their strategies.
The Future of Algo Trading in the Forex market
The future of algo trading in forex is bright, as advances in technology continue to make algorithmic systems greater powerful and available. Artificial intelligence (AI) and system mastering are already being integrated into buying and selling algorithms, enabling them to evolve to changing market situations and enhance performance over the years.
In addition, the upward thrust of decentralized finance (DeFi) and cryptocurrencies provides new opportunities for algo traders. Algorithms can be evolved to exchange now not handiest conventional currencies but also digital belongings, further expanding the capacity for earnings.
Moreover, the continued improvement of faster and extra efficient buying and selling infrastructure will permit foreign exchange investors to execute even more complex and high-frequency techniques, staying beforehand of the opposition.
Conclusion
Algo trading in foreign exchange has transformed the manner traders have interaction with the currency markets, offering pace, efficiency, and the ability to execute complex techniques that might be not possible manually. As the forex market continues to adapt, so too will the gear and strategies to be had to buyers. For folks that master auto trading in Asia and past, algorithmic structures can provide a effective side in this exceedingly aggressive area, ensuring lengthy-time period profitability and boom.
